So, just to be clear, if I purchase a Core Rulebook manual that says 2nd Printing or such, when it arrives in the mail, it actually will be the printing that was advertised on Paizo's website?


You should always receive the most recent printing of any book bought directly from Paizo. If you order a CRB it will be 6th printing at the moment.

There's probably not a strict guarantee, however I generally 'upgrade' my books when a new printing of a book comes out and I've only had an 'out of date' book once in all that time.


Thanks. I'd really prefer to purchase my Pathfinder books via Amazon.com due to the discount but I have no way of knowing what printing I'd be getting so I'll have to settle for Paizo's store.

Paizo Employee Chief Technical Officer

Yeah—paizo.com will always ship the most current printing of a product (though note that products sold as "non-mint" could be any printing). We can't vouch for any other source, though.
